Claims (1)

  1. 입력 디지탈 영상 신호를 복수의 화소 데이타에서 되는 블럭 단위의 데이타에 변환하는 블럭화 수단과, 상기 블럭화 수단의 출력 데이타를 상기 블럭 단위에 압축 부호화하는 부호화 수단과, 상기 부호화 수단의 출력 부호화 데이타를 채널 부호화하는 채널 부호화 수단에서 되는 기록 회로를 가지는 디지탈 비디오 신호의 자기 기록 장치에 있어서, 상기 자기 테이프의 제1속도로서 기록하는 제1기록 모드와, 상기 제1속도의 1.5배의 제2속도로서 기록하는 제2기록모드를 가능하게 하도록, 상기 자기 테이프의 속도를 절환하는 수단과, 상기 채널 부호화 수단의 출력 항상 데이타를 자기 테이프에 기록하기 위한, 회전 드럼에 180°간격으로 장착되고, 각각의 트랙폭이 상기 제2의 기록 모드에 있어서 트랙 피치와 같던지 약간 크게 되고, 각각의 갭의 연장 방향이 다르게 된 제1및 제2자기 헤드를 가지는 것을 특징으로 하는 디지탈 비디오 신호의 자기 기록 장치.
